projects
/
carl9170fw.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
mac80211: Update mesh constants to approved IEEE ANA values
[carl9170fw.git]
/
carlfw
/
include
/
wl.h
diff --git
a/carlfw/include/wl.h
b/carlfw/include/wl.h
index 47dda502bcd7a60ec912d79143327359096a6fc5..4f0c76de42fd324ac4553da504916aad69bf3d4a 100644
(file)
--- a/
carlfw/include/wl.h
+++ b/
carlfw/include/wl.h
@@
-259,16
+259,26
@@
static inline __inline __hot void read_tsf(uint32_t *tsf)
void wlan_tx(struct dma_desc *desc);
void wlan_timer(void);
void handle_wlan(void);
void wlan_tx(struct dma_desc *desc);
void wlan_timer(void);
void handle_wlan(void);
-void wlan_tx_stuck(const struct carl9170_cmd *cmd, struct carl9170_rsp *rsp);
+
+void wlan_cab_flush_queue(const unsigned int vif);
+void wlan_cab_modify_dtim_beacon(const unsigned int vif,
+ const unsigned int bcn_addr,
+ const unsigned int bcn_len);
static inline void __check_wlantx(void)
{
static inline void __check_wlantx(void)
{
+ BUILD_BUG_ON(CARL9170_TX_SUPERDESC_LEN & 3);
BUILD_BUG_ON(sizeof(struct carl9170_tx_superdesc) != CARL9170_TX_SUPERDESC_LEN);
BUILD_BUG_ON(sizeof(struct carl9170_tx_superdesc) != CARL9170_TX_SUPERDESC_LEN);
+ BUILD_BUG_ON(sizeof(struct _carl9170_tx_superdesc) != CARL9170_TX_SUPERDESC_LEN);
+ BUILD_BUG_ON(sizeof(struct _carl9170_tx_superframe) != CARL9170_TX_SUPERFRAME_LEN);
BUILD_BUG_ON((offsetof(struct carl9170_tx_superframe, f) & 3) != 0);
BUILD_BUG_ON((offsetof(struct carl9170_tx_superframe, f) & 3) != 0);
+ BUILD_BUG_ON(offsetof(struct _carl9170_tx_superframe, f) !=
+ (offsetof(struct _carl9170_tx_superframe, f)));
BUILD_BUG_ON(sizeof(struct ar9170_tx_hwdesc) != AR9170_TX_HWDESC_LEN);
BUILD_BUG_ON(sizeof(struct ar9170_tx_hwdesc) != AR9170_TX_HWDESC_LEN);
- BUILD_BUG_ON(sizeof(struct ar9170_rx_head) != 12);
- BUILD_BUG_ON(sizeof(struct ar9170_rx_phystatus) != 20);
- BUILD_BUG_ON(sizeof(struct ar9170_rx_macstatus) != 4);
+ BUILD_BUG_ON(sizeof(struct _ar9170_tx_hwdesc) != AR9170_TX_HWDESC_LEN);
+ BUILD_BUG_ON(sizeof(struct ar9170_rx_head) != AR9170_RX_HEAD_LEN);
+ BUILD_BUG_ON(sizeof(struct ar9170_rx_phystatus) != AR9170_RX_PHYSTATUS_LEN);
+ BUILD_BUG_ON(sizeof(struct ar9170_rx_macstatus) != AR9170_RX_MACSTATUS_LEN);
}
#endif /* __CARL9170FW_WLAN_H */
}
#endif /* __CARL9170FW_WLAN_H */